What is live video broadcasting?• Real-time, live video or audio• Streamed over the Internet• Can be interactive
• Makes marketing more convenient and cost-effective– Increased global brand recognition
• Introduction of virtually reality to the technology community – Make it possible for people to as if they are at an event
• Increased user mobility• Use of celebrity livestreaming
